Alert: Orphaned-resource sweeper (Gleanwright) triggered. This alert fires when the sweeper in the Pellamy platform detects plugin-created resources whose owning plugin has been uninstalled or disabled. Orphans are quarantined for 72 hours before deletion, giving authors time to reclaim them. Plugin authors should ensure teardown hooks release all provisioned resources, since quarantined items count against your plugin's quota. Reclamation steps, quota details, and the sweeper's detection rules are described on the internal page below.

dashboard of yafog-fajof = https://jira.tolvaqsys.internal/pages/pages/projects/49fe21c4

- [ ] **CrashFunnel pipeline keys.** Before we rotate the signing keys for the CrashFunnel mobile crash-report pipeline, have both custodians present and confirm the Hartelle HSM is in ceremony mode. Double-check the old key's revocation notice is drafted — we skipped that last time and it was a headache. Once everyone's signed the attendance sheet, unlock the ceremony vault using the recovery passphrase below.

recovery phrase for bawef-haduf: wenax-druox-julmir

## TICKET-4471: Signature check failure blocking checkout load tests

For the weekly sync: the CartStorm load-test harness against the Lumabuy checkout flow is failing at startup with a signature mismatch on the test-runner artifact. Root cause: the harness was rebuilt Tuesday but signed with the retired January key, so the verifier rejects it. Load numbers for this sprint are blocked until we re-sign. Fix is straightforward — rebuild, then re-sign with the active key. The correct signing key is:

release key, fajef-kajeg: bky19_LdLu6Ne6FLi8he2c24d

## Deployment

The Lumacache image service has a known slow leak in its thumbnail cache layer: evicted entries keep a reference alive through the decoder pool, so resident memory creeps up roughly 40 MB per hour under steady load. Until the refactor in the Harkness branch lands, we mitigate by capping pool size and scheduling a rolling restart every 12 hours. Deploy with the supervisor, never bare, or the restart hook won't fire. The deployment relies on the configuration values listed below.

settings of bagug-tahof:
holath:
  pin: 7837
  metrics_host: metrics.holath.tolvaqsys.internal
  tenant: quenath
  seal: seal_6001b3af